今天给各位分享c语言可以描述rtl的知识,其中也会对c语言中可以用来说明函数的是进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
本文目录一览:
行为级和RTL级的区别
1、一般理解就是:功能仿真和时序仿真。 也可以叫 RTL级仿真 和 Gate-level仿真也可以叫 功能仿真(RTL)、综合后仿真(post-synthesis)和布局布线仿真(Gate-level)。 其实,就看你从哪里划分了。
2、鉴于这个区别,RTL级描述的目标就是可综合,而行为级描述的目标就是实现特定的功能而没有可综合的限制。行为级是RTL的上一层,行为级是最符合人类逻辑思维方式的描述角度,一般基于算法,用C/C++来描述。
3、RTL级,register transfer level,指的是用寄存器这一级别的描述方式来描述电路的数据流方式而Beh***ior级指的是仅仅描述电路的功能而可以***用任何verilog语法的描述方式鉴于这个区别,RTL级描述的目标就是可综合,而行为级描述。
C语言是种什么语言
C语言是一门面向过程的计算机编程语言,与C++、Java等面向对象编程语言有所不同。C语言的设计目标是提供一种能以简易的方式编译、处理低级存储器、仅产生少量的机器码以及不需要任何运行环境支持便能运行的编程语言。
C语言是一种结构化语言。它层次清晰,便于按模块化方式组织程序,易于调试和维护。C语言的表现能力和处理能力极强。它不仅具有丰富的运算符和数据类型,便于实现各类复杂的数据结构。
C语言是一种计算机程序设计语言。它既有高级语言的特点,又具有汇编语言的特点。它可以作为系统设计语言,编写系统应用程序,也可以作为应用程序设计语言,编写不依赖计算机硬件的应用程序。因此,它的应用范围广泛。
C语言是一种面向过程的语言是相对于面向对象程序设计语言(如C++,J***a等)而言的。面向过程就是以实现最终目标为目的,对于事物缺乏抽象描述(即建模)。面向对象通过引入类的概念弥补了这一缺点。
C语言是在B语言的基础上发展起来的,它的根源可以追溯到ALGOL 60。 1960年出现的ALGOL 60是一种面向问题的高级语言,它离硬件比较远,不宜用来编写系统程序。
C语言是一种结构化的语言,提供的控制语句具有结构化特征,如for语句、ifelse语句和switch语句等。可以用于实现函数的逻辑控制,方便面向过程的程序设计。
计算机硬件描述语言(VHDL)与编程语言(C语言)的区别及关系,
1、首先说VHDL:它是描述电路的计算机工具,早期的CPLD等器件是基于与-或阵列的,更容易说明这点,VHDL是描述电路行为的,当下载到器件后,它就是具体的电路,这个电路全由与-或阵列组成。
2、VHDL是硬件描述语言,用来做硬件设计的;C语言是软件编程语言,用来编写软件程序的。一个是用来设计硬件系统的,一个是用来设计软件系统的,用途完全不同,不可同日而语。
3、两个语言没有什么联系。前者是面向硬件的,有点类似单片机。一个是面向软件的,是计算机编程。语法结构没什么大的相似。都是编程语言。如果你要制造一个定时***的定时系统,VHDL。
如何用C语言导入RTL的数据?
可以通过文件读写导入数据。例如: fp=fopen(文件名,r); 打开文件,便可读入。(2)可以通过键盘输入。例如 scanf(), gets() 之类。例如: 命令行文件转向。(3)命令行 位置[_a***_]输入。
先明确你的问题。数据源是数据库还是文件,导入是指读取到内存,还是写入另一个数据库或文件中。数据库种类很多,需要写对应的连接代码或使用现成接口。文件读写,使用fopen获取文件流(根据读写需求传参)。
C语言产生ASCII数据文件,使用空格做作为数据分隔符。
c语言可以描述rtl的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于c语言中可以用来说明函数的是、c语言可以描述rtl的信息别忘了在本站进行查找喔。